Shanghai doesn’t sleep; it just changes clothes. For most, the city's nightlife feels like a wall of neon. The real challenge involves more than finding a beat. You have to navigate the velvet ropes. Peak energy hits on Thursday nights. Tables often require steep minimum spends. If you don't have a local promoter's WeChat, you're likely standing in the cold.
The scene splits between two distinct worlds. At Linx, the "old guard" still orders magnums under aggressive strobe lights. Then there’s the red-lit intimacy of Le Baron. It feels like a private house party for the fashion set. ASL keeps the bass heavy and the guest list tight. When the sun starts to rise, the techno crowd migrates to Celia by Pulse. That's where the city’s underground stays awake.

01.Le Baron
What is it? Le Baron is a nightclub that defines Shanghai nightlife. You walk through the doors and immediately hit the pulse of a high-energy party. The space wraps you in an atmosphere of pure luxury.
Why we love it: House and hip-hop beats dictate the rhythm of the room. The bass moves through the floor as the crowd dances under the lights. It turns a standard night into an intense, focused party.
Good to Know: The house sets at Le Baron hit their stride well after midnight, so plan your arrival to align with the peak of the dance floor energy.

03.M1NT
What is it? M1NT is a Shanghai nightclub that anchors the city’s late-night scene. You walk past a signature shark tank that immediately establishes a sharp, dramatic atmosphere. The room is designed for impact, pulling the crowd into a space that feels both focused and fast-paced.
Why we love it: The energy here matches the intensity of Shanghai after dark. We love the way the glow from the shark tank reflects off the surfaces as the night reaches its height. It is a visual experience that relies on its unique environment to create a sense of place.
Good to Know: The energy at M1NT peaks well after midnight, which is the best time to see the signature shark tank under the club's full lighting.

06.Celia by Pulse
What is it? Celia by Pulse is a Shanghai nightclub that thrives in the dark. The space feels raw and intentional. It serves as a dedicated hub for the city’s late-night crowd.
Why we love it: The underground energy defines the experience. Rhythms pulse through the room, keeping the floor moving while the rest of the city sleeps. It is a place where the atmosphere carries the night and the outside world disappears.
Good to Know: Celia by Pulse is a true after-hours destination. The energy here does not hit its peak until well after the clock strikes two.
